Key Features to Consider Before Buying Before purchasing a home treadmill, keep the following specifications in mind toensure the maker fits specific needs: Motor Power (CHP): Look for a minimum of 1.5 to 2.0 Continuous Horsepower(CHP)for walking and light jogging. Major runners training for endurance occasions should search for 2.5 CHP or higher to ensure the motor can

manage sustained high speeds without overheating. Running Deck Size

: A longer and wider belt offers safety and comfort, particularly for taller users or those with a longer stride. A minimum length of 130cm and width of 45cm is suggested for running

. Cushioning: Running outdoors on concrete takes a heavy toll on knees and ankles. Quality treadmills include elastomer cushioning systems that take in as much as 30 %more effect than roadway running. Folding Mechanism: Hydraulic or easy-lift folding systems enablethe deck to be safely stowed away vertically when not in usage. Benefits of Owning a Home Treadmill Incorporating

Privacy: Exercise easily at your own rate without the pressure of a crowded industrial fitness center flooring. Regularly Asked Questions(FAQ)1. How much area do Irequire for a home treadmill? Typically, you must designate an area roughly 2 metres long by 1 metre large for the treadmill itself. Furthermore, safety standards recommend leaving a minimum of 1 metre of clear area behind the treadmillin case of a journey or fall. 2. Do home treadmills use a lot of electrical energy? While treadmills do work on electrical energy, their power intake is comparable to other household

home appliances like a toaster or hair dryer(

usually in between 500W to 1500W depending upon user weight and speed). Running for 30 minutes a day will generally add just a couple of pounds to a month-to-month

energy expense. 3. Do I need a membership to utilize a smart treadmill? Many modern-day discount treadmills (such as NordicTrack or Peloton)function largescreens developed to run proprietary streaming software like iFit. While these machines normally have a "manual mode"that works without a membership, you will lose out on the interactive featuresunless you pay the regular monthly charge. Non-smart treadmills(like JTX or Reebok )operate entirely individually without continuous subscriptions. 4. How do I keep and take care of my treadmill? To ensure longevity, keep the running belt tidy and complimentary of dust. Most makers advise lubing the running deck with silicone-based

lubricant every 3 to 6 months, depending upon usage frequency. Always disconnect the device before carrying out

any upkeep. Last Thoughts Finding the very best home treadmill small in the UK comes down to stabilizing 3 crucial aspects: your budget plan, your readily available area, and your fitness objectives.
